5 Efficient Countermeasures Against Water Damage from a Burst Water Pipe
What should you do if a water pipe ruptureds in your home, developing a mini-waterfall as well as swamping an area of your residence? The longer you wait, the a lot more extreme the water damages in your building. For these reasons, you need to discover what to in case of a ruptured water pipe.

Shut down the Main Waterline Valve



The first thing you need to do is shut the shut-off shutoff. Look for the local shut-off valve to turn-off water in one particular area only. You have to turn-off the main waterline valve if you do not recognize where the local shut-off valve to the fixture is. This will certainly remove the water in your entire house. Normally, the primary valve is found outside the residence alongside the water meter. If it's not there, you can also locate it in the basement at an eye-level or it could be in the first floor on the ground. Generally, contractors but the shut-off shutoff in the main ground degree restroom or appropriate next to it.

Call Water Damage Remediation Pros for Help



After closing the water resource, call the pros for aid. With their specialist assistance, you can alleviate worsening due to the fact that water can leak through your points resulting in deformed baseboards, loosened ceramic tiles, or damages structure.

Document the Damage For Insurance policy



As you are waiting for the pros to arrive, record the damages triggered by the errant pipeline. Staying proactive with this allows you to submit a claim for coverage, which will certainly assist you and also your family get back on your feet.

Recover Things That Can Be Conserved



Once you're done taking photos, read the items and take out one of the most crucial ones from the stack. Dry them off and attempt to preserve as high as you can. Drag them away from moisture so they can begin to dry.

Begin the Drying Refine



While waiting for the pros, you can start the drying process. Thankfully, water from your waterlines are clean so you don't have to stress over drain water. Nevertheless, the moving water might have interrupted the dirt as well as debris in your carpets and also floorboards. Be prepared with gloves as you make use of containers to dump out the water. After that, blot out as high as you can with old towels. You can also switch on an electrical fan or open home windows to promote air circulation. This will quicken drying out as well as hinder mold as well as mildew development.

Specialists are the just one certified to deal with the burs pipelines and subsequent damages. And also bear in mind, pipelines don't just suddenly ruptured. You will typically see red flags like bubbling paint, unusual sounds in the plumbing, moldy odor, caving ceiling, peeling off wallpaper, or water spots. Take note of these points, so you can nip any concerns in the bud.
